Selenium Medical employs 55 employees. The Selenium Medical management team includes Arnaud Castiglia (Account and Project Manager), Damien Uijttewaal (Chief Executive Officer and Directeur Général), and Ivan Fereol (Product and Process Validation Manager).
Looking for a particular Selenium Medical employee's phone or email?